Output 3052b385593e00609aafe4f5c9012accaa2a549863e114c2e3dca5fdd213c53d:42

value
19265802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49bc1e95a19a98f0c51abbd1a0bb5973c20b579f OP_EQUAL
address
MEd2vCmmFXjfD3kugBBQMzbeWG1dWoFXuC
transaction
3052b385593e00609aafe4f5c9012accaa2a549863e114c2e3dca5fdd213c53d
spent
true